Removing 3M pressure-sensitive adhesives requires a strategic combination of thermal softening, chemical solvency, and mechanical friction to break the cross-linked polymer bonds without damaging the underlying substrate. Success is measured by the complete removal of the acrylic or rubber-based mass while maintaining the integrity and surface finish of the host material, typically achievable through a systematic multi-stage solvent application process.

Surface Compatibility and Remediation Planning

Before applying any chemical agent, you must identify the chemical composition of the substrate. 3M adhesives are engineered to adhere to a wide variety of surfaces including glass, anodized aluminum, painted steel, and high-energy plastics. Using the wrong solvent—such as high-concentration acetone—on an ABS or polycarbonate plastic will induce chemical stress cracking or permanent marring.



  • Essential Gear and Solvent Checklist
  • Plastic razor blades or soft-edged polymer scrapers (to prevent gouging).
  • High-purity Isopropyl Alcohol (IPA) 70% to 90% concentration for residue cleanup.
  • 3M Specialty Adhesive Remover (a citrus-based aerosol) or Naphtha for heavy-duty extraction.
  • Microfiber cloths, lint-free towels, or non-abrasive shop rags.
  • Heat gun or hair dryer (for thermal softening of the adhesive matrix).
  • Nitrile gloves for chemical protection and to prevent skin oils from contaminating the surface.

Estimated procedural duration ranges from 15 to 45 minutes depending on the cure age of the adhesive. If the adhesive has been exposed to UV radiation for multiple years, the polymer chains will have undergone significant degradation, requiring a more aggressive chemical softening phase rather than mechanical peeling.

Systematic Adhesive Extraction Workflow



Step 1: Thermal Softening of the Polymer Matrix

Apply heat to the adhesive area to transition the acrylic polymer from a glassy state to a rubbery state. Set your heat gun to a low-temperature setting, generally between 120 and 150 degrees Fahrenheit. Hold the heat source 6 to 8 inches from the surface, moving in a continuous sweeping motion to avoid localized hot spots that could warp plastic or blister paint.

Warning: Do not exceed 200 degrees Fahrenheit on automotive clear coats or sensitive plastics. Excessive heat can cause permanent discoloration or permanent structural deformation of the substrate.



Step 2: Mechanical De-lamination

Once the adhesive is softened, use a plastic scraper at a 30-degree angle to lift the edge of the 3M tape. Work slowly, applying consistent, low-tension pressure. If you encounter resistance, re-apply heat. Do not force the removal, as this increases the likelihood of tearing the backing or pulling top-coat layers off the substrate.



Step 3: Chemical Solvent Application

After the bulk of the tape is removed, a thin layer of adhesive residue (the "tack") will remain. Saturate a microfiber cloth with 3M Specialty Adhesive Remover or high-grade Naphtha. Lay the damp cloth over the remaining residue and allow it to dwell for 60 to 90 seconds. This dwell time allows the solvent to penetrate and swell the adhesive, effectively breaking its surface tension.



Step 4: Final Surface Cleansing

Once the residue has emulsified into a gel-like consistency, use a clean edge of your cloth to wipe the surface in one direction. Do not rub the softened adhesive back into the pores of the material. Once the adhesive is removed, perform a final pass using 70% Isopropyl Alcohol to neutralize any remaining solvent chemicals and prepare the surface for any necessary re-bonding or finishing.

Pro-Tip: If working on glass or bare metal, you can use a fine-gauge plastic scrub pad for stubborn residue, but always verify the surface is cool before initiating mechanical scrubbing to prevent surface scratching.

Technical Comparison of Adhesive Removal Agents



Agent Type Best For Material Risk Primary Mechanism
Isopropyl Alcohol Minor residue Low Polar solvent dissolution
Naphtha/VM&P Thick adhesive Moderate Hydrocarbon swelling
3M Specialty Remover Industrial residue Low (if wiped) Citrus terpene softening
Acetone Bare metal/Glass High (Melts plastic) Rapid polymer breakdown
Heat (Thermal) Initial bonding Moderate (Heat warping) Viscosity reduction

Managing Common Field Failures and Surface Damage

Field-level issues usually stem from aggressive mechanical force or improper solvent selection. Proper remediation requires patience rather than brute force.



  • Root Cause: Substrate Marring or Scratching. This occurs when metal scrapers or abrasive pads are used. Actionable Fix: Immediately switch to polymer or wood-based scrapers. Use a polishing compound with a fine-grit microfiber pad to buff out minor surface hazing caused by friction.
  • Root Cause: Adhesive Smearing. This happens when the solvent is not allowed enough dwell time, causing the adhesive to turn into a sticky, spreadable sludge. Actionable Fix: Stop all movement. Re-saturate the area with the solvent, let it dwell for two full minutes, and use a fresh cloth to lift the material rather than pushing it across the surface.
  • Root Cause: Ghosting or Discoloration. Certain plastics experience UV-induced aging where the area under the tape is protected while the surrounding area fades. Actionable Fix: This is rarely an adhesive failure. Use a mild plastic restorer or an automotive-grade light cutting polish to blend the surrounding surface color to match the area that was protected by the adhesive.

Frequently Asked Questions



Will nail polish remover effectively remove 3M adhesive?

Most consumer-grade nail polish removers contain acetone, which is highly effective at dissolving adhesives but poses a severe risk to plastics and synthetic finishes. Only use acetone on bare metal or tempered glass, and ensure you are working in a well-ventilated area to manage solvent inhalation risks.



How do I remove 3M tape from automotive paint without damaging it?

The safest approach is to use a 3M specialty adhesive remover designed for automotive applications combined with a plastic razor blade. Avoid metallic scrapers at all costs, and always perform a small spot test in an inconspicuous area, such as the inside of a door jamb, to ensure the solvent does not react with the clear coat.



Is WD-40 safe for removing 3M adhesive residue?

While WD-40 can help loosen some light adhesive residues due to its mineral oil content, it is not a professional-grade solvent. It leaves an oily film that is difficult to remove, which will interfere with any future painting or re-adhesion steps. It is better to use a dedicated citrus-based adhesive remover or high-purity IPA.



What should I do if the adhesive is years old and won't lift?

Old, UV-baked adhesive becomes brittle and loses its chemical reactivity. You must use heat to soften the polymer back to a malleable state. If that fails, apply a specialized heavy-duty adhesive remover via a saturated paper towel covered with plastic wrap to prevent evaporation, allowing it to sit for 15 minutes before attempting removal.



Can I use a hair dryer instead of a professional heat gun?

Yes, a hair dryer is often safer for beginners because it operates at lower peak temperatures, reducing the risk of melting plastic trim or blistering paint. You will need to hold the dryer closer to the surface and increase your dwell time to achieve the same thermal softening results as a professional heat gun.
